Transaction 8390779c031376f645233fa10bc420e28356788cc12be763c56b0ee5b013f07c
1 Input
1 Output
-
8390779c031376f645233fa10bc420e28356788cc12be763c56b0ee5b013f07c:0
- value
- 12153579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db4ad06a173069aad09316f83e8b9c9a9821f1cb OP_EQUAL
- address
- 3MgXXjLQ6r9XNYnik7hGBaeYjojGW6xcNL